zomg
This is not the ugliest code I have ever written.
The handling of HTTP/1.1 chunked transfer-encoding is a horrible hack. The indentation isn't quite as random as I would like. I have other complaints, but I've forgotten them, as zomg does mostly what I want, which is to play music and report it to Last.fm. Unfortunately, it lacks the power of vux, but that's another story.
zomghelper is a C program that extracts the relevant data from an Ogg Vorbis file. It written because vorbiscomment doesn't report the track length, and ogginfo is much too slow for my needs. I don't expect most people to share my needs, so the five of you that are actually going to use zomg probably won't need it.
Posted on 2005-12-07
Tags: quanks